Soldering is a process of joining two metal surfaces together using a low-melting-point metal alloy called solder. It's a fundamental skill used in various areas including electronics, plumbing, and jewelry making. Here's a soldering how to / beginner's guide to soldering:

What you need to solder:

  • Soldering iron
  • Solder
  • Flux
  • Cleaning sponge
  • Helping hands or a third hand tool (optional)
  • Wire cutters/strippers
  • Adequate ventilation equipment and protective eyewear

Steps : 

  1. Clean the surface: Ensure the metal surfaces you want to join are clean and free of rust, oil, or dirt. Use sandpaper or a wire brush to clean them up.
  2. If you plan to use a heat shrink tube to protect the soldered joint when you are finished, do not forget to place it on one of the wires you plan to solder, before you solder. Otherwise, you could have to break and re-solder the joint again!
